+/// The Unicode “display width” of a string.
|
|
|
+///
|
|
|
+/// This is related to the number of *graphemes* of a string, rather than the
|
|
|
+/// number of *characters*, or *bytes*: although most characters are one
|
|
|
+/// column wide, a few can be two columns wide, and this is important to note
|
|
|
+/// when calculating widths for displaying tables in a terminal.
|
|
|
+///
|
|
|
+/// This type is used to ensure that the width, rather than the length, is
|
|
|
+/// used when constructing a `TextCell` -- it's too easy to write something
|
|
|
+/// like `file_name.len()` and assume it will work!
|
|
|
+///
|
|
|
+/// It has `From` impls that convert an input string or fixed with to values
|
|
|
+/// of this type, and will `Deref` to the contained `usize` value.
|
|
|
+#[derive(PartialEq, Debug, Clone, Copy, Default)]
|
|
|
+pub struct DisplayWidth(usize);
|
|
|
+
|
|
|
+impl<'a> From<&'a str> for DisplayWidth {
|
|
|
+ fn from(input: &'a str) -> DisplayWidth {
|
|
|
+ DisplayWidth(UnicodeWidthStr::width(input))
|
|
|
+ }
|
|
|
+}
|
|
|
+
|
|
|
+impl From<usize> for DisplayWidth {
|
|
|
+ fn from(width: usize) -> DisplayWidth {
|
|
|
+ DisplayWidth(width)
|
|
|
+ }
|
|
|
+}
|
|
|
+
|
|
|
+impl Deref for DisplayWidth {
|
|
|
+ type Target = usize;
|
|
|
+
|
|
|
+ fn deref<'a>(&'a self) -> &'a Self::Target {
|
|
|
+ &self.0
|
|
|
+ }
|
|
|
+}
|
|
|
+
|
|
|
+impl DerefMut for DisplayWidth {
|
|
|
+ fn deref_mut<'a>(&'a mut self) -> &'a mut Self::Target {
|
|
|
+ &mut self.0
|
|
|
+ }
|
|
|
+}
